7‘Siro Sonnet’ sheer fabric, Black Edition
Black EditionTo create the dappled effect on this sheer, a method known as devoré (or burnout) has been used, where some of the fibres are dissolved during the printing process to leave areas of delicate transparency. £179 per metre, blackedition.com

10‘Oishi’ sheer fabric, Kieffer
KiefferTalked-about designers of the moment FormaFantasma’s new sheer, ‘Oishi’, for Rubelli’s sister brand Kieffer, takes an unusual approach: a linen warp with a weft handmade from Japanese paper cut into thin strips. £224 per metre, rubelli.com
